FROM THE BELLY OF THE BEASTS –
TOO MUCH WHISKEY; & WAY TOO MUCH CAFFEINE:
A Boston/New York showcase featuring Shaun Wolf Wortis,
Bourbon Princess, Lach and Testosterone Kills. On Friday, June 20,
the Zeitgeist Gallery in Cambridge puts on an eclectic and truly
alternative bill of quirky performers from Boston and New York. From
Boston, there’s the dark swamp whiskey grooves of both Shaun Wolf
Wortis and Monique Ortiz’ Bourbon Princess, and from New York City,
two overly-stimulated mainstays of the Lower East Side “antifolk”
scene, Lach, and “Elektrofolk” duo Testosterone Kills.
Shaun Wolf Wortis, former Slide frontman and shaman leader of the
infamous Mardi Gras Balls lays down loose, staggering, soul-rock with
“finely crafted tunes” (Billboard). “Wortis teeters, at times, on the
brink of the void”. -The Tab
Bourbon Princess: Monique Ortiz leads her unusual group through a
dark, smoky, post-punk soundtrack set to her beat poetry.
Lach: Legendary “antifolk” ringleader from New York. Irreverent
beyond belief and brilliant to boot. “Lach is a star! More Woody
Allen than Woody Guthrie and a raised middle finger to the folk
purists.” (New Musical Express); “Like black snow, stalled subway
cars and random violence, Lach is a Manhattan institution.” (NY Times)
Testosterone Kills: Queens NY based “way gay” acoustic duo has gained
a following in Manhattan coffeehouses blending antifolk themes with a
bit of odd-ball electronic … This “antifolk” group ain’t exactly
Simon and Garfunkel … “Smart, hip, incredibly hummable.” (Out
Magazine).
